Такие объемы лучше с помощью БД обрабатывать.
А исходные данные нельзя сразу в желаемом виде получать, раз большой и длительный проект?
Если структура таблиц меняться не будет, то сделанный 1 раз VBA-макрос можно применять сколько угодно на новых файлах.
|